Anshula Kapoor opens up about missing mom Mona during engagement; says Boney Kapoor wanted her wedding at home: ‘The grief has resurfaced so strongly’

Anshula Kapoor spoke about her engagement ceremony and revealed why they she and fiance Rohan Thakkar decided to organise it at home.

Boney Kapoor’s eldest daughter, Anshula Kapoor, got engaged to her longtime boyfriend, Rohan Thakkar. She shared photos from the ceremony on social media, which saw the entire Kapoor clan come together for the couple’s Gor Dhana ceremony, a Gujarati pre-wedding ritual which is essentially an engagement ceremony. Among those present were her brother Arjun Kapoor and half-sisters Janhvi Kapoor and Khushi Kapoor, who joined in to celebrate the couple’s new beginning. In a recent interaction, Anshula spoke about the ceremony and revealed why they chose to organise it at home.

Sharing the reason behind hosting the ceremony at home, she told Hindustan Times, “Rohan and I always imagined our gor dhana to be a close knit celebration with family. We wanted it be cozy, warm, intimate, and we are glad that’s exactly how it turned out to be.”

Anshula also spoke about Boney Kapoor’s reaction when she told him about her decision to get married. “When I had first spoken with dad and my siblings about knowing that Rohan and I were ready to take the next step in our relationship, dad was the most excited and he said he only has one wish – that I get married at home. So keeping that wish in high regard, I wanted our first ceremony to be held at his house. I’m so grateful that Rohan and his family embraced that wholeheartedly,” she said.

Anshula revealed that for the Gor Dhana ceremony, her outfit paid tribute to Rohan’s Gujarati roots, and she kept her ensemble a surprise for him– he only got to see her look at the ceremony. “Rohan is deeply connected to his roots, and it was important to me to honour that. My lehenga reflected those influences with Bandhini, traditional Kutch embroidery and mirror work woven into it.” She added, “Rohan didn’t want to know or see what I was wearing until the day and the look in his eyes when he first saw me meant everything and more.”

Anshula admitted that she had been missing her mother, Mona Shourie Kapoor, ever since Rohan proposed to her in New York. She said, “Since the day Rohan proposed, I’ve been missing mum even more. The grief has resurfaced so strongly, and I knew I needed her close to me. That’s why I had her words, ‘Rab Raakha’ embroidered on the back of my outfit. She was always my wings, my biggest support system, and I knew I needed to feel her with me while I’m at the cusp of starting a new chapter in my life. More than ever.”

For the unversed, Anshula is Boney Kapoor’s eldest daughter from his first wife, Mona Shourie Kapoor. The couple also had a son, actor Arjun Kapoor. Boney and Mona were married from 1983 to 1996. During their marriage, Boney was in a relationship with the late actor Sridevi. The two later separated, and he married Sridevi in 1996. The couple had two daughters together — Janhvi Kapoor and Khushi Kapoor.
